## Alert: StatRelay Sidecar Flush Lag

This alert fires when the StatRelay metrics-aggregation sidecar falls more than 120 seconds behind on flushing buffered samples to the Coalmine backend. Plugin-emitted counters are buffered in-process, so sustained lag usually means a plugin is emitting unbounded label cardinality or blocking the flush thread. Check your plugin's metric registration against the published cardinality limits before escalating. If the lag persists after your plugin is ruled out, contact the telemetry team.

escalation mailbox, bagug-fahof: novdor.wendor.jormir@norvalabs.example

# Artifact Signing — FilterFront

Welcome aboard! FilterFront is the bloom filter layer that sits in front of the Pebblestore key-value cluster and saves us a ton of pointless disk lookups. Releases are built by the Tumbleweed pipeline, and yes, every artifact gets signed — no exceptions, even for quick patches. When you pull a build for staging, always check the signature first; it takes ten seconds. For verification, use the release signing key below.

signing key of bagap-yawep = bky13_TbfT6ZMUoGJo2

### Step 3: Point producers at the Lanternfield schema registry

Before Thursday's sync, every event producer must register its schemas with Lanternfield rather than embedding them inline. Compatibility mode is set to backward-transitive, so breaking changes will be rejected at publish time. Validate each subject locally with the dry-run flag first. Once validation passes, update each producer's startup settings to the values listed below.

deployment values, tafog-fajef:
[jorox]
team = norael
access_code = ac_b6e7bf
owner = oliael.silwyn
host = jorox.qorveltech.internal
port = 8443
peer = oliius.paliqlabs.local
salt = 0b6288ee
pin = 8391

Q: How does StormRelay fan out weather alerts?

A: The Cloudmere ingest node receives bulletins from the Vantery feed, deduplicates by alert ID, and pushes to regional queues. Each queue worker signs its batch before delivery to subscriber gateways. Reviewers: check the retry path — failed batches re-sign with the standby key, which lives in the sealed ops vault. To open that vault during review, use the passphrase below.

unlock words, kajef-kadug: sorys-pelax-lamael-tamvan-briiel-novdor-fenwyn-tamdor-oliion-keleth-julok-belion-ralok